Al-Qouz for Creative Leadership: An Inspiring Platform in the Realm of Cultural Industries

Dubai’s Culture and Arts Authority has announced the commencement of preparations for the third edition of the “Al Quoz Creative Entrepreneurship Forum.” The objective of this event is to empower entrepreneurs and small to medium-sized business owners, encouraging them to develop and enhance their projects. Additionally, the forum aims to highlight the significance of the cultural and creative industries sector, showcasing various opportunities and support systems that align with Dubai’s vision to become a global hub for the creative economy by 2026. This initiative reflects the authority’s commitment to investing in youth potential and talent.

### Forum Highlights

The forum, scheduled to take place in the Al Quoz Creative Zone during the fourth quarter of this year, will feature a series of discussions with notable experts in entrepreneurship and the creative industries. Participants can look forward to interactive workshops, networking sessions, and panel discussions that will address various topics related to enhancing entrepreneurship. The event will also include a range of activities designed to help businesses refine their entrepreneurial skills.

### Al Quoz Creative Entrepreneurship Competition

In addition, the Dubai Culture Authority has opened applications for the third edition of the “Al Quoz Creative Entrepreneurship Competition,” which will take place alongside the forum. This competition aims to foster healthy competition among entrepreneurs and small to medium-sized business owners, motivating them to present innovative ideas that contribute to the development of the entrepreneurship sector in Dubai. This aligns with Dubai’s strategy for the creative economy, which seeks to connect creative projects with investment opportunities.

### Participation Details

Dubai Culture is accepting applications for the Al Quoz Creative Entrepreneurship Competition until June 30. Entrepreneurs who make it to the shortlist will have the chance to present their projects to attendees of the Al Quoz Creative Entrepreneurship Forum, along with a jury of industry experts, investors, and partners of the forum. The selected projects will be evaluated based on several criteria, including creativity, uniqueness, competitive edge, commitment to sustainability regarding resources and revenue, potential impact on the cultural and creative sectors, and understanding of market needs.
